#2b9626 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b9626 is composed of 16.9% red, 58.8%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 117.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 36.9%. #2b9626 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ff4c with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#2b9626 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b9626 has RGB values of R:43, G:150,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 2856486.

Shades and Tints of #2b9626
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b9626
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596359 is the less saturated color, while #0aba02 is the most saturated one.
